A community mental health center is a center that offers a range of mental health treatment and counseling services for both adults and children. |
|
What Services do Community Mental Health Centers offer? |
Community Mental Health Centers offer these core services:
- Outpatient services, including specialized outpatient services for children, the elderly, individuals who are chronically mentally ill, and residents of the CMHC’s mental health service area who have been discharged from inpatient treatment at a mental health facility
- 24 hour-a-day emergency care services
- Day treatment, or other partial hospitalization services, or psychosocial rehabilitation services; and
- Screening for patients being considered for admission to State mental health facilities to determine the appropriateness of such admission.
